It may be a bit soon to write stories about Christmas, but it looks like poor Santa is in danger of going bankrupt thanks to the current financial crisis.
Specifically, the Santa Claus Office in Finland is in trouble because of falling visitor numbers from Greece, Spain, Italy and Russia.
Traditionally, the Lapland office receives hundreds of thousands of visits each year from children wanting to visit Santa. But it is struggling to repay £140,000 of debts and has been given less than a week to come up with the money – or if will face bankruptcy.
Takings were badly hit as austerity hit the southern European countries. Then Russians stopped coming because of the financial sanctions thanks to the Ukraine crisis.
However, tourism officials from the area say that the office is not the only Santa Claus themed business in the region, and the others remain open. So Christmas will still go ahead.
